그린 전자 가속기 시장 규모는 최근 급성장하고 있습니다. 시장 규모는 2025년 28억 7,000만 달러에서 2026년에는 32억 4,000만 달러로, CAGR은 13.2%를 나타낼 전망입니다. 지난 몇 년간의 성장 요인으로는 산업 폐수 처리 요건 강화, 의료 분야에서의 방사선 살균 사용 확대, 식품 안전 및 식품 방사선 조사 용도 확대, 배출물에 대한 환경 규제 강화, 산업 공정에서의 전자빔 기술 채택 등을 들 수 있습니다.

그린 전자 가속기 시장 규모는 향후 몇 년간 급성장이 전망되고 있습니다. 2030년까지 53억 7,000만 달러에 이르고, CAGR은 13.4%를 나타낼 전망입니다. 예측 기간 동안의 성장은 재생에너지 기반 가속기로의 전환, 지속 가능한 폐기물 처리 솔루션에 대한 수요 증가, 소형 가속기 설계 기술의 발전, 친환경 산업 인프라에 대한 투자 증가, 의료 및 제약 분야에서의 멸균 응용 분야 확대에 기인할 것으로 예측됩니다. 것으로 판단됩니다. 예측 기간 동안 주요 동향으로는 에너지 효율이 높은 전자 가속기 기술의 채택 확대, 폐수 및 배출가스 처리에 전자 가속기 활용 증가, 소형 및 휴대용 전자 가속기 시스템에 대한 수요 증가, 의료용 멸균 및 폐기물 관리 분야에서의 응용 확대, 고정밀 빔 제어 및 효율 최적화 등이 있습니다. 효율 최적화의 진전 등을 들 수 있습니다.

에너지 효율에 대한 인식이 높아짐에 따라 향후 그린 전자 가속기 시장의 성장을 가속할 것으로 예측됩니다. 에너지 효율이란 동일한 수준의 성능을 달성하기 위해 더 적은 에너지를 사용하면서 낭비를 최소화하는 것을 말합니다. 에너지 효율에 대한 인식 증가는 비용 절감에 의해 주도되고 있습니다. 에너지를 보다 효율적으로 사용하게 되면, 광열비가 절감되어 전체 운영비가 절감되기 때문입니다. 그린 전자 가속기는 높은 성능을 유지하면서 산업 및 의료 공정에서 에너지 사용량을 줄일 수 있게 해주고, 지속가능한 에너지 사용의 실질적인 이점을 입증함으로써 에너지 효율 향상에 기여합니다. 예를 들어, 2025년 3월 미국의 영향력 있는 에너지 효율화 정책 단체인 Alliance to Save Energy에 따르면, 2024년 미국의 에너지 효율화 정책은 2.8%의 경제 성장에 기여한 반면, 1차 에너지 소비는 전년 대비 0.5% 증가에 그쳤고, 그 결과 에너지 생산성은 2.3% 향상되었습니다. 따라서 에너지 효율에 대한 인식이 높아지면서 그린 전자 가속기 시장의 성장을 주도하고 있습니다.

그린 전자 가속기 시장에서 활동하는 주요 기업들은 지속 가능한 산업 공정을 지원하고, 환경에 미치는 영향을 줄이고, 운영 효율성을 향상시키기 위해 첨단 에너지 효율이 높은 조사 솔루션을 개발하고 있습니다. 에너지 효율이 높은 조사 솔루션은 전자빔(e-beam) 기술을 사용하여 화학물질을 사용하지 않고 재료를 살균 및 처리하며, 동시에 에너지 소비를 줄입니다. 예를 들어, 2024년 3월, 벨기에에 본사를 둔 입자 가속기 기술 제공업체인 IBA Worldwide는 독일에 'Be Efficient' 전자빔 조사 시스템을 설치하는 계약을 체결하였습니다. 이 시스템은 에너지 소비와 운영 비용을 줄이면서 높은 선량 성능을 달성하고, 환경 친화적인 살균 및 산업 응용을 촉진합니다. 폐기물을 최소화하고 방사성 물질의 사용을 없애고, 의료, 포장, 첨단 소재 등의 분야에서 지속가능성을 높임으로써 보다 환경 친화적인 조사 기술로 전환하는 것을 상징합니다.

A green electron accelerator is a type of particle accelerator engineered to produce high-energy electron beams using environmentally friendly technologies. It emphasizes reducing energy consumption and minimizing harmful emissions compared to conventional accelerators. These accelerators are employed in applications that require precise electron beams.

The essential product types of green electron accelerators include linear, compact, and industrial electron accelerators. Linear accelerators accelerate electrons in a straight line using electromagnetic fields for various treatment and processing applications. They operate using renewable and conventional energy, applied across industrial wastewater, medical wastewater, medical solid waste, antibiotic residue, flue gas treatment, and other applications. End users include healthcare facilities, food processing companies, industrial manufacturing units, and research institutes.

Tariffs have impacted the green electron accelerator market by increasing the cost of critical components such as high-energy power systems, vacuum equipment, and precision electronics, thereby raising overall system prices. These effects are most prominent in industrial electron accelerators and compact systems, with regions like Asia-Pacific and Europe experiencing supply chain disruptions due to reliance on imported components. Applications in industrial manufacturing and wastewater treatment are particularly affected as cost sensitivities are higher. However, tariffs have also encouraged local manufacturing and innovation in energy-efficient accelerator technologies, supporting the development of cost-effective and sustainable solutions within domestic markets.

The green electron accelerator market size has grown rapidly in recent years. It will grow from $2.87 billion in 2025 to $3.24 billion in 2026 at a compound annual growth rate (CAGR) of 13.2%. The growth in the historic period can be attributed to growth in industrial wastewater treatment requirements, increasing use of radiation sterilization in healthcare, expansion of food safety and irradiation applications, rising environmental regulations on emissions, adoption of electron beam technologies in industrial processing.

The green electron accelerator market size is expected to see rapid growth in the next few years. It will grow to $5.37 billion by 2030 at a compound annual growth rate (CAGR) of 13.4%. The growth in the forecast period can be attributed to increasing shift toward renewable energy-powered accelerators, growing demand for sustainable waste treatment solutions, advancements in compact accelerator design technologies, rising investment in green industrial infrastructure, expansion of medical and pharmaceutical sterilization applications. Major trends in the forecast period include increasing adoption of energy-efficient electron accelerator technologies, rising use of electron accelerators in wastewater and emission treatment, growing demand for compact and portable electron accelerator systems, expansion of applications in medical sterilization and waste management, advancements in high-precision beam control and efficiency optimization.

The rising awareness of energy efficiency is expected to propel the growth of the green electron accelerator market going forward. Energy efficiency refers to using less energy to deliver the same level of performance while minimizing waste. The rise in awareness of energy efficiency is driven by cost savings, as using energy more efficiently reduces utility bills and lowers overall operational expenses. A green electron accelerator helps energy efficiency by enabling industrial and medical processes to use less energy while maintaining high performance, demonstrating the practical benefits of sustainable energy use. For instance, in March 2025, according to the Alliance to Save Energy, a US-based high-impact energy efficiency policy, in 2024, US energy efficiency policies contributed to a 2.8% economic growth, while primary energy consumption rose only 0.5% year-on-year, leading to a 2.3% increase in energy productivity. Therefore, rising awareness of energy efficiency is driving the growth of the green electron accelerator market.

Key companies operating in the green electron accelerator market are developing advanced, energy-efficient irradiation solutions to support sustainable industrial processes, reduce environmental impact, and improve operational efficiency. Energy-efficient irradiation solutions use electron beam (e-beam) technology to sterilize and treat materials without chemicals while consuming less energy. For example, in March 2024, IBA Worldwide, a Belgium-based particle accelerator technology provider, signed a contract to install the Be Efficient electron beam irradiation system in Germany. The system delivers high-dose performance with reduced energy consumption and operational costs, promoting eco-friendly sterilization and industrial applications. It represents a shift toward greener irradiation technologies by minimizing waste, eliminating the need for radioactive sources, and enhancing sustainability in sectors such as healthcare, packaging, and advanced materials.

In October 2025, CGN Dasheng, a China-based nuclear technology equipment manufacturer, partnered with the Institute of Nuclear Chemistry and Technology (INCT) to deliver its first electron accelerator to the European Union. Through this collaboration, CGN Dasheng seeks to expand its global presence in the green electron accelerator market by supplying advanced irradiation technology for environmental and industrial applications while promoting international cooperation and technology exchange. The Institute of Nuclear Chemistry and Technology is a Poland-based research institute actively engaged in electron accelerator technologies with environmental (green) applications.
